Output 11f4a9ef77d9798dfe08bf1163d12fbb349d6c89e6960a8b14fb1891833c9040:1

value
18691600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f7e452e6569aeaa89e8c62fb1ce31681f33962 OP_EQUALVERIFY OP_CHECKSIG
address
1DDMqLwvfUjUfnXrr9fBKbDmfD9rW7poQn
transaction
11f4a9ef77d9798dfe08bf1163d12fbb349d6c89e6960a8b14fb1891833c9040
confirmations
511066
spent
true